  7. 16 hours ago, smokeybandit said:

    I think it's a poor idea to base which cruise to book on the projected cost of a drink package.

    When comparing the total price for a cruise, I always include the drinks package price to get the overall cost of the cruise. It would be much easier if they had a set price like Princess & MSC.

     

    I compared my last cruise to Norway on Princess with the same 7 day cruise on Anthem. Without the drinks package , Anthem was cheaper, but when you added on Drinks package, Gratuities & Wifi, the Princess price came in around £500 cheaper with the Plus package for the 2 of us..
